    H3C Switch Multimode Optical Module

    The H3C SFP GE SX MM850 A is a Gigabit Ethernet SFP optical module designed for short-range fiber connections using multimode fiber. It operates at 850nm and supports the 1000BASE-SX standard, enabling up to 1Gbps transmission for distances typically reaching 550m depending on the.     Bending radius of industrial single-mode optical fiber

    For standard single-mode fibers, the minimum radius is 20x the cable diameter under load or 10x in the load-free state, but at least 30 mm or 15 mm. IEC 60794 specifies mechanical properties of fiber optic cables: Part 1-2 defines bending radii for different cable types and test.
